He who, knowing this, meditates on this four-sixteenth quarter of Brahman as the Shining becomes shining in this world; and he wins shining worlds — he who, knowing this, meditates on this four-sixteenth quarter of Brahman as the Shining.
HinduTeachingGod KnowledgeMeditationSanskrit
Chandogya Upanishad 4.5.3
